Hello, several months ago i worked out that the reason my car had been running rough was the air flow meter was broken and secondly the Lambda sensor was 1. broken to 2. noy connected. I purchased a new sensor and due to the previous owner of the car taking a chain saw to the wiring had to re solder the wires on the harness. I nice man with an autodata set up gave me all the releveant coulourd wires just to make sure i was connecting the right wires back to the right wires ( if you catch my drift. ) Today on the way back from town the car started playing up and i only just made it back coupled to this it was only doing 10 mpg where it had been doing 27 mpg. I thought ah that old chest nut the lambda sensor has gone again. I plug in my code scanner a sure enough it came back with lambda sensor. I checked the joints id soldered and re did a few of them becasue i didnt know if it was a dry joint etc. Ran the car again ( after reseting the fault codes ) and the car runs like a bag of S&*TE but when i plug the code reader in it dosnt through up the lambda sensor code. Is it possible that the wiring is now ok but the sensor is not returning the correct voltage to the ECU so the code reader is not picking up the fault code because there is no broken wires etc. Also with out spending a vasrt amount of money on manuals where can i get an electrinic wiring diagram so i can check out a few things on this car.
